Mid-infrared Laser Technology: Shaping the Next Decade of Sensing and Imaging
The mid-infrared (mid-IR) laser market is witnessing significant growth due to its increasing applications in healthcare, defense, spectroscopy, and industrial processing. Mid-IR lasers operate in the wavelength range of 2-20 micrometers, offering unique capabilities in molecular sensing, thermal imaging, and environmental monitoring. The market is driven by advancements in laser technology, rising demand for gas sensing applications, and the growing need for non-invasive medical diagnostics. The global mid-infrared laser market is expected to grow at a robust CAGR 9.6% from 2023 to 2031, driven by technological innovations and the expanding use of mid-IR lasers across various industries. The adoption of quantum cascade lasers (QCLs) and fiber lasers in spectroscopy and medical applications is expected to further accelerate market growth.
